Internal valence modulates the speed of object recognition.

Summary
Momentary affect influences object recognition speed by altering neural responses in visual and affective brain regions. This demonstrates how emotions impact perception early in processing.
Area of Science:
- Cognitive Neuroscience
- Affective Neuroscience
- Visual Perception
Background:
- Strong structural connections exist between brain regions processing affect and visual information.
- The functional impact of these connections on perception remains largely unexplored.
- Understanding how momentary emotional states influence visual perception is crucial.
Purpose of the Study:
- To investigate the influence of induced affect (pleasant or unpleasant) on object recognition.
- To explore the neural mechanisms underlying affect's impact on perception.
- To determine if affect modulates functional interactions between affective and perceptual brain areas.
Main Methods:
- Induced pleasant or unpleasant affect in human participants.
- Recorded neural activity using magnetoencephalography (MEG) during an object recognition task.
- Analyzed evoked responses in occipitotemporal cortex and affective regions.
Main Results:
- Affect significantly influenced the speed of object recognition.
- Neural activity speed and amplitude in occipitotemporal cortex and affective regions were modulated by affect.
- Functional interactions between affective and perceptual regions were altered by affect early in processing.
Conclusions:
- Momentary affect serves as a significant contextual influence on object recognition.
- Affect modulates neural processing in both perceptual and affective brain networks.
- These findings highlight the dynamic interplay between emotion and perception.

Association areas are regions of the cerebral cortex that do not have a specific sensory or motor function. Instead, they integrate and interpret information from various sources to enable higher cognitive processes such as memory, learning, and decision-making. Some key association areas include the following:

The brain processes sensory information rapidly due to parallel processing, which involves sending data across multiple neural pathways at the same time. This method allows the brain to manage various sensory qualities, such as shapes, colors, movements, and locations, all concurrently. For instance, when observing a forest landscape, the brain simultaneously processes the movement of leaves, the shapes of trees, the depth between them, and the various shades of green.
